I have been reading them, but let's examine everything. As the link to the blog post shows, the owner of the site only makes money on commision; that is, when someone clicks on the ads and then buys something (as i thought it was). The owner of the site, like the blog says, has also been from the site TheHungerSite. Let's consider a few things here: Since revenue is based on commission, viewing the ads alone doesn't bring in revenue. There are, also, apparently more people gaining rice than they are buying things. If there is any money left over, it can go to TheHungerSite and its sister sites. Yes, the money could also go to himself, like for payment for the hosting of the site, the maintainers of the site, his personal life, etc, but we'll just have to trust his word on this from what he mentions in the FAQs. As for the calculations, that would be true if they weren't just guessing. For the time being, the rice has increased, and if you want to prove his actions, then perhaps you should mail the people they're donating to and see if anything has been received from them on their part. |
